LeanTaaS is seeking a driven and collaborative Strategy & Operations professional to join our growing team. In this role, you will own high-impact strategic analyses, translate insights into actionable recommendations, and lead initiatives that drive business growth and operational improvement. You will report to the Associate Director of Strategy & Operations and partner closely with executive leadership to support board reporting, strategic planning, and key financial decisions.
WHAT YOU'LL DO
- Function as an effective resource to executives, management teams, and our board of directors
- Advise and partner with senior management and the C-suite to develop and implement growth strategies for each product line
- Direct the strategic and business planning for enterprise initiatives, product business line strategies, and operational improvements for the company
- Develop perspectives on market conditions, competition, opportunities, and strategic relationships to be considered for each product line
- Create actionable insights and implement strategies to help grow and support the business
- Own and manage key operational metrics and KPIs for the business units and company
- Create scalable internal processes and systems that connect and support company operational improvement across Finance, Customer Success, and Go-to-Market (GTM)
- Communicate analyses and recommendations to key leaders across the organization
WHAT YOU'LL BRING
- Minimum 2-5 years of post-bachelor's experience in management consulting, finance, and/or strategy and operations
- Strong analytical and quantitative skills, including financial modeling, scenario analysis, and large-scale data analysis (Excel / Google Sheets)
- Experience using generative AI tools to improve workflows and productivity is strongly preferred
- Comfort working with business systems such as Salesforce, Notion, and customer success platforms (e.g., ChurnZero), or willingness to learn quickly
- Experience building presentations and communicating complex ideas clearly and concisely
- Excellent communication skills with the ability to influence stakeholders from operators to executives and board members
- Passion to solve challenging problems, hunger to learn, and conviction to drive change
- Excitement to learn more about the healthcare ecosystem;
- Prior healthcare provider and/or healthcare software/technology experience is a plus
- Excitement to join an expanding strategy and operations team at a PE-backed growth-stage company
